This collection is called 'Medusae Pendant Collection' designed by Roxy Russell who gained inspiration for these lamps from the ocean of course.
What's interesting is that not only does she admire the boundless beauty and mysteries of the ocean, but also the sad state of the eco-system because of all the plastic we keep dumping in there.
"I wanted to bring to the surface, and illuminate the growing problem of plastic polluting our oceans in a way that makes people inspired to help." she says in an interview.
But the irony here is that the very lamps she designs are made of plastic as well!
Russell first assures that the plastic in entirely recyclable and argues that versatility plastic materials have become an integral part of our lives and eliminating it completely is not possible. One can however, make a conscious effort to use only recyclable plastic and reuse it as much as possible. Russell contributes a percentage of profits from these lamps to The Ocean Conservancy.
Coming back to the lamps, as beautiful they are...their price is quite steep. They cost between $325 to $425.
